Austin isn’t just hosting the NFB national convention—it’s the fun you get to have in between sessions!
When your custom agenda wraps for the day, you can head straight into Austin’s legendary live music scene, with bands playing everything from blues and country to rock and indie in bars and venues all over downtown. Grab tacos from a late‑night food truck, line up for famous Texas barbecue, or wander South Congress for coffee and dessert.
If you want to unwind outdoors, you can stroll or roll along the Ann and Roy Butler Trail around Lady Bird Lake, relax in Zilker Park, or just enjoy the skyline from the waterfront. On a free afternoon, you might tour the Texas State Capitol, check out local museums, or explore Austin’s quirky shops and murals that give the city its “keep Austin weird” vibe. Barton Springs Pool is spring fed and stays around 68–70 degrees year‑round, which feels wonderfully icy on a blazing Austin summer day.
